CVE-2026-61050: Difficult to exploit vulnerability allows low privileged attacker with network access via HTTP to compromise Oracle Production Scheduling. Successful attacks of this vulnerability can result in unauthorized access to critical data or complete access to all Oracle Production Scheduling accessible data. in Oracle Corporation Oracle Production Scheduling
Vulnerability in the Oracle Production Scheduling product of Oracle E-Business Suite (component: User Interface). Supported versions that are affected are 12.2.3-12.2.15. Difficult to exploit vulnerability allows low privileged attacker with network access via HTTP to compromise Oracle Production Scheduling. Successful attacks of this vulnerability can result in unauthorized access to critical data or complete access to all Oracle Production Scheduling accessible data. CVSS 3.1 Base Score 5.3 (Confidentiality impacts). CVSS Vector: (CVSS:3.1/AV:N/AC:H/PR:L/UI:N/S:U/C:H/I:N/A:N).

Technical Summary
This vulnerability exists in the User Interface component of Oracle Production Scheduling versions 12.2.3 to 12.2.15. It can be exploited remotely over the network via HTTP by an attacker with low privileges. The vulnerability allows unauthorized access to sensitive data within the affected product, compromising confidentiality without impacting integrity or availability. The CVSS vector indicates a network attack vector requiring high attack complexity and low privileges, with no user interaction needed. Oracle's July 2026 Critical Patch Update advisory references this vulnerability but does not explicitly confirm patch availability or remediation status for this specific issue.
Potential Impact
Successful exploitation can lead to unauthorized access to critical or all data accessible by Oracle Production Scheduling, resulting in a confidentiality breach. There is no indication of impact to data integrity or system availability. The vulnerability is considered difficult to exploit and requires network access and low privileges.
Mitigation Recommendations
Patch status is not yet confirmed — check the Oracle July 2026 Critical Patch Update advisory for current remediation guidance. Oracle strongly recommends applying security patches promptly and remaining on actively supported versions. No specific workaround or temporary fix is documented in the advisory for this vulnerability at this time.
